Japanese lander enters lunar orbit
Posted: Sat, Dec 30, 2023, 9:52 AM ET (1452 GMT)
SLIM lunar lander (JAXA) A Japanese spacecraft has entered orbit around the moon ahead of a landing next month. The Smart Lander for Investigating Moon (SLIM) spacecraft performed a three-minute engine burn early Monday to enter an elliptical orbit around the moon. SLIM will gradually lower its orbit to set up a landing attempt on Jan. 19. SLIM launched in September along with a Japanese astronomy spacecraft, and flew a low-energy trajectory to the moon. The spacecraft is designed to demonstrate precision landing technologies.
